Easter, also known as Pasha, is significant for many, including Christians and non-Christians. Its name comes from the Anglo-Saxon goddess Eostre and marks a time for unity and celebration. The various Easter activities, such as parades, communal dancing, the Easter Bunny, and Easter eggs, reflect this shared celebration.
